Lawrence, Kansas Information & Statistics

Quick Facts

The 2018 population estimate for Lawrence is 95,294, a change of 5.65% when compared to 2014. With an area of 34.97 square miles, this works out to a population density of 2,725.12 persons/mi2.
The number of households in 2018 were estimated to be 37,557, with an average household size of 2.33.
Lawrence's 2018 unemployment rate was 4.31%.
The average household income in Lawrence for 2018 was $70,883, while the median was $50,429.

Lawrence Population Data

Period Geography Population
2014 Lawrence city, Kansas 90,194
2015 Lawrence city, Kansas 91,305
2016 Lawrence city, Kansas 92,611
2017 Lawrence city, Kansas 93,954
2018 Lawrence city, Kansas 95,294
